The national average interest rate for savings accounts under $100,000... WebYou'll pay earnest money by cashier's check, personal check, or wire transfer. Your earnest money will be deposited into an escrow account or held by the listing agent. Once the sale of the home has been completed, the earnest money you paid will be applied toward your closing costs.

WebTo review the complete regulatory definition of "money services business", click here. If your business is an MSB, the business must comply with the BSA requirements applicable to financial institutions as well as to each of the specific requirements applicable to MSBs.
